American Express Crypto Back

As I was perusing the Reddits, I came across an article that immediately caught my attention. American Express has announced the first credit card on its network to offer crypto rewards. We've had crypto debit cards for a long time at this point, and I've used a couple of them. There's not a lot of crypto credit cards out there though, and none of the few offered are backed by major payment processors like American Express.

Yesterday, I took a look at the new Edge Mastercard, which is the first ever crypto debit card that requires no KYC. This new card from American Express will absolutely require KYC, because it's a credit card after all. It's being created in partnership with Abra, which is a crypto app that I've used a handful of times. It's a crypto wealth management platform that supports hundreds of cryptocurrencies and it has been around for a long time.

This card will be supercharged with rewards in cryptocurrency combined with American Express' already great rewards on travel, shopping, and dining. Another major advantage to using this card for purchases is AmEx's purchase protection. The rewards will be available on any purchase, but the percentage or however the rewards are calculated has yet to be announced.

This may not sound very exciting when you first think about it... But you have to realize that American Express is one of the biggest payment processors that exists. They offer some of the best benefits to using their credit cards for payments, and that is being combined with cryptocurrency. Think about that. American Express + Cryptocurrency.

Not only can you use the card to build your credit, but you can use the card to stack crypto. Then if you want to, you can trade that crypto within the Abra app without having to transfer it to a different exchange. No annual fees and no foreign transaction fees to top it off. This is truly going to be a game changer for the average credit card user that doesn't have experience with crypto.

According to Wikipedia, there were around 114 million American Express credit cards issued. That number has increased since then, and I'm sure it will continue to do so as more cards with different perks keep rolling out. Imagine those 114 million card members starting to earn crypto rewards on all their purchases. Talk about network effect.
